Click here. You can start checking the status of your refund within 24 hours after you e-filed your return. The refund information is updated on the IRS website once a day, overnight.
"However, if you mailed your return and expect a refund, it could take four weeks or more to process your return," the IRS said. According to the IRS, the average refund amount for 2024 is $3,050.
3. Troubleshoot any problems. If there's a problem with your refund that requires you to contact the IRS, the refund status checker will let you know to do so.
Where’s My Refund? is the most popular tool the IRS offers. In 2022, 54 million taxpayers used it: 16% of the U.S. population, as Yellen said at a Treasury Department event on Tuesday.
Over 200 million people, or 83% of taxpayers, file their tax returns electronically with the average refund being $3,000. The IRS would like to push that number of e-filings even higher.
